Features

  • Product includes - Two super supports with built-in anti-slip strips to hold tracks in place. The super supports help you build bridges and other constructions and enhance your BRIO world.
  • Perfect for the creative toddler - Expand your budding engineer's collection with the Super Supports train accessory. Its a fun gift designed for ages 3 and up.
  • Compatibility - As your child develops, so can their railway play as the Super Supports are compatible with all other BRIO railway toys.
  • Develops important skills - Playing with train sets helps children to understand and learn about their environment in a fun way.
  • Safe for your child - We conduct more than 1, 000 safety tests a year to ensure that our products conform to all safety standards, and we take pride in developing toys that are completely safe for children to play with.

Description

Build bridges and overcome any obstacle in your way. These BRIO bridge supports for any BRIO wooden railway system help to elevate your layout From the Manufacturer Stackable supports with built-in anti-slip strips

  • Nice supports for a wooden train track layout.
These supports are very sturdy and the anti-slip strips are a nice option. They support and hold the track very well. However they are not quite the same height as the Thomas & Friends track supports. While they are pretty much compatible there is a slight difference. The other drawback that we saw was the price. Ended up seeing the same supports in a local high-end toy store for a little less than what we paid. Bottom line - these are nice supports that can add levels to your wooden train track layouts, but you might want to shop around for a better price. ... show more

  • These Deeper Lipped edges prevent tracks from sliding off
I got these for my grand kids because I noticed how frustrated they would get when they've built an elaborate track system, only to accidentally knock their supports over. These supports hold the tracks nicely because they prevent the tracks from sliding over and off the lipped edges. The lipped edges are deeper than other wooden block supports we have. These are a nice addition to the track sets we have. ... show more
